在当今数字化时代,企业和个人都越来越依赖网络传输敏感信息,保障网络安全成为核心议题。而搭建一套稳定可靠的VPN服务器,不仅可以有效保护数据隐私,还能实现远程安全访问,为用户带来更高的安全保障。本文将详细介绍如何在服务器上成功创建VPN以保障网络安全,帮助您解决实际需求,提升网络安全层级。
深入理解VPN的重要性与作用
VPN(虚拟私人网络)是一种通过公共网络建立起安全通信通道的技术。它的主要作用是加密数据传输,防止信息在传输过程中被窃取或篡改。同时,VPN还能隐藏用户的真实IP地址,防止位置追踪和网络监听。企业通过搭建VPN,可以让远程员工安全访问公司内部资源,而个人用户也能在公共Wi-Fi环境下保障隐私安全。

准备工作:选择合适的VPN类型与服务器环境
在搭建VPN之前,首先需要明确所需VPN的类型。常见的VPN类型包括:
- IPSec/IPSec VPN:适合企业内部网络,安全性高,配置复杂。
- SSL VPN:用户通过浏览器访问,配置简便,支持多平台。
- OpenVPN:开源免费,安全性高,兼容性强。
选择适合自己需求的VPN类型后,要准备一台稳定的服务器,建议使用Linux发行版如Ubuntu或CentOS,因其稳定性和安全性优良。
详细步骤:在服务器上搭建VPN环境
- 更新服务器系统
确保系统版本是最新的,执行以下命令以更新软件包:
sudo apt update
sudo apt upgrade
- 安装VPN软件
以OpenVPN为例,安装命令如下:
sudo apt install openvpn easy-rsa
- 配置证书和密钥
使用easy-rsa生成CA证书、服务器证书和密钥,为VPN通信增加安全层级。配置流程包括初始化PKI、构建证书和密钥、签发证书等步骤。
- 配置OpenVPN服务器
编辑/etc/openvpn/server.conf文件,设置端口、协议